YUMI f Japanese
From Japanese 弓 (yumi) meaning "archery bow". It can also come from 由(yu) meaning "reason, cause", 友 (yu)meaning "friend" or a nanori reading of 弓(yu) meaning "archery bow" combined with 美 (mi) meaning "beautiful". Other kanji or kanji combinations are also possible.
